What is the name of Bell's airport?
Organise a flight to Bell and you'll be disembarking at Frankfurt - Hahn Airport (HHN).
How far is Frankfurt - Hahn Airport (HHN) from central Bell?
If you plan on staying in central Bell, it's a smart idea to work out how you'll get into the city before you touchdown. The downtown area is approximately 16 kilometres from Frankfurt - Hahn Airport (HHN).
What airport is best to fly into Bell?
Frankfurt-Hahn Airport is the only major airport in Bell. Before you head there, it's a good idea to find out a thing or two about it. The terminal sits about 16 kilometres from the centre of town.
How many airlines fly to Bell?
You have a few options if you're travelling to Bell. Choose from 4 airlines that service this city from at least 34 airports worldwide.
How many nonstop flights are there to Bell?
Arranging an exciting Bell getaway is child's play when there are 108 nonstop flights each week to get you there.
Where are the most popular flights to Bell departing from?
A large number of flights to Bell set off from London, Catania and Alicante airports.
How long is the flight to Bell Airport?
If you're flying to Bell from London, you're looking at a flight time of 1 hour and 15 minutes. Those setting off from Catania can expect to be on the plane for 2 hours and 40 minutes. From Alicante it's 2 hours and 40 minutes away.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of banned items can differ between air carriers, the general rule of thumb is avoid carrying anything fl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es screwdrivers, knives, fuel and fireworks. Sports equipment like baseball bats, and objects that could harm other people, such as guns and swords, aren't allowed in the cabin either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Your aim is to feel as comfortable as you can. Opt for slip-on footwear, dress in loose, breathable clothing and don't forget to bring a sweater in case you get cold in the cabin.
  • The result of lengthy periods of inactivity, de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a blood clotting condition that can affect some passengers during long-distance flights. Lower your risks by staying hydrated, keeping your legs moving and wearing compression socks to help your circ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Bell?
It's easy — be prepared. We've compiled some helpful hints for a speedy trip through security. Watch out Bell, here you come:

  • Airport security personnel first need to know that you have a valid ID and matching travel documents before you're allowed to proceed any further. Have them close by, ready for inspection.
  • After that, both you and your hand luggage must be X-rayed. To make the process quick and painless, remove anything that might trigger the alarms. Personal belongings like your belt, jacket and earphones will be required to go through the machine.
  • Your electronic devices like phones and laptops will also need to go on a tray to be scanned. No need to worry though, you'll be back online soon enough.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as shampoo or hand cream, that you want to take on board need to be in containers no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res). Also, they all must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), zip-lock bag.
  • It's also likely that you'll be asked to remove your shoes to be X-rayed, so wearing slip-on sneakers is always a wise idea.
  • Airlines won't allow any sharp items or pocket knives to come on board with you. If you need to bring these kinds of items, put them in your checked luggage.
